E. coli biotin ligase (BirA) is highly specific in covalently attaching biotin to the 15 amino acid AviTag peptide. This recombinant protein was biotinylated in vivo by AviTag-BirA technology, which method is BriA catalyzes amide linkage between the biotin and the specific lysine of the AviTag.

Target Background

Function
Binds to the 60S ribosomal subunit and prevents its association with the 40S ribosomal subunit to form the 80S initiation complex in the cytoplasm. Behaves as a stimulatory translation initiation factor downstream insulin/growth factors. Is also involved in ribosome biogenesis. Associates with pre-60S subunits in the nucleus and is involved in its nuclear export. Cytoplasmic release of TIF6 from 60S subunits and nuclear relocalization is promoted by a RACK1 (RACK1)-dependent protein kinase C activity. In tissues responsive to insulin, controls fatty acid synthesis and glycolysis by exerting translational control of adipogenic transcription factors such as CEBPB, CEBPD and ATF4 that have G/C rich or uORF in their 5'UTR. Required for ROS-dependent megakaryocyte maturation and platelets formation, controls the expression of mitochondrial respiratory chain genes involved in reactive oxygen species (ROS) synthesis. Involved in miRNA-mediated gene silencing by the RNA-induced silencing complex (RISC). Required for both miRNA-mediated translational repression and miRNA-mediated cleavage of complementary mRNAs by RISC. Modulates cell cycle progression and global translation of pre-B cells, its activation seems to be rate-limiting in tumorigenesis and tumor growth.
Gene References into Functions
  1. in human CD4(+) T cells, eIF6 levels rapidly increase upon T-cell receptor activation and drive the glycolytic switch and the acquisition of effector functions PMID: 28743432
  2. Studies indicate that eukaryotic translation initiation factor 6 (eIF6) is a central regulator of metabolism independent from mTOR protein and myc proto-oncogene protein (Myc). PMID: 27913676
  3. Propose that eIF6 is necessary for malignant pleural mesothelioma growth. PMID: 26462016
  4. EIF6 plays an important role in controlling cell motility and tumor metastasis. PMID: 25886394
  5. eIF6 is a node regulator of ribosomal function and predict that prioritizing its pharmacological targeting will be of benefit in cancer and Shwachman-Bodian-Diamond syndrome PMID: 25252159
  6. SBDS protein facilitates the release of eIF6, a factor that prevents ribosome joining. PMID: 23115272
  7. eIF6 is one of the downstream effectors of Notch-1 in the pathway that controls cell motility and invasiveness in tumor cell lines PMID: 22348144
  8. The interactions between P311 and ITGB4BP may be very important in the process of tumor cell differentiation and metastasis. PMID: 22365962
  9. The benign prognosis of the Shwachman-Diamond syndrome patients with the int del (20)(q11.21q13.32) may be due to a gene/dosage effect for the EIF6 protein. PMID: 22295858
  10. Inhibiting the induction of two proteins involved in two of the most significantly upregulated cellular processes, ribosome biogenesis (eIF6) and hnRNA splicing (SF3B2/SF3B4), showed that human T cells can enter the cell cycle without growing in size. PMID: 22415777
  11. a direct role for SBDS and EFL1 in catalyzing the translational activation of ribosomes in all eukaryotes, and define SDS as a ribosomopathy caused by uncoupling GTP hydrolysis from eIF6 release PMID: 21536732
  12. P311 and ITGB4BP expression was elevated in non-small cell lung cancer, possibly indicative of a new signaling pathway. PMID: 21029697
  13. Ca(2+)-activated calcineurin phosphatase binds to and promotes nuclear localization of eIF6.Nuclear export of eIF6 is regulated by phosphorylation at Ser-174 and Ser-175 by the nuclear isoform of CK1. PMID: 21084295
  14. eIF6 release regulates ribosome subunit joining and RACK1 provides a physical and functional link between PKC signalling and ribosome activation PMID: 14654845
  15. ITGB4BP is overexpressed in head and neck cancers and its metastases. PMID: 15122657
  16. Human eIF6 promoter contains consensus sites for the GABP (GA-binding protein) transcription factor complex. PMID: 16530192
  17. results uncover an evolutionarily conserved function of the ribosome anti-association factor eIF6 in miRNA-mediated post-transcriptional silencing PMID: 17507929
  18. Nuclear matrix proteins such as mutant Pyst1 and nucleophosmin 1 were downregulated, whereas eIF6 and beta-tubulin were upregulated during cell differentiation in hepatocarcinoma cells. PMID: 17569113
  19. definitive evidence that eIF6 and dicer are both upregulated in a significant proportion of ovarian serous carcinomas PMID: 18327211

Subcellular Location
Cytoplasm. Nucleus, nucleolus. Note=Shuttles between cytoplasm and nucleus/nucleolus.
Protein Families
EIF-6 family
Tissue Specificity
Expressed at very high levels in colon carcinoma with lower levels in normal colon and ileum and lowest levels in kidney and muscle (at protein level).
